update on Hilo Hattie and shirts with themes!
So, we see that Hilo Hattie has been sold to Donald Kang for $3 million. Mr. Kang is planning a museum for Hawaiian shirts. We spoke to the staff back in 2006 about a history of HH. No one had that! For the collector and vintage lovers of Aloha, history and labels are important. GO Mr. Kang!
then we found someone did a sales breakdown by theme for Hawaiian shirts and found (at one store) the top 5 selling themes are: #5 - automotive theme, #4 - geometric patterns (tapa), #3 - novelty prints (drinks, festivals, holidays, etc), #2 - floral prints and coming in at #1 - follage prints.
